Estimated Price Range

$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)

$5,000 - $15,000 (larger landscape project)

Project Type Typical Range
Small decorative rock bed $1,200 - $2,800
Pathway or walkway $2,500 - $6,000
Large landscape feature $7,000 - $15,000
Retaining wall with rocks $10,000 - $25,000
Full yard landscaping with rocks $15,000 - $50,000

Factors Affecting Cost

Landscaping rock installation involves the placement of various types of rocks to enhance outdoor spaces. The scope of the project can vary depending on materials chosen, size, and complexity, influencing overall costs and effort involved.

  • Materials: Options include natural stone, gravel, decomposed granite, or crushed rock, each with different textures and appearances.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small decorative accents to extensive ground cover across large areas.
  • Labor Complexity: Installation difficulty depends on terrain, rock size, and design intricacies, affecting labor requirements.
  • Permitting: Local regulations may require permits for certain types or quantities of rock installation, especially in larger projects.
  • Additional Features: Edging, weed barriers, or decorative accents may be added to customize the installation and improve durability.

Project Size and Scope

Scope/Size Typical Range
Small Decorative Rocks (1-2 inches) $3 - $5 per square foot
Medium Rocks (2-4 inches) $4 - $6 per square foot
Large Rocks (4-12 inches) $6 - $12 per square foot
Base Layer (Crushed Rock or Gravel) $2 - $4 per square foot
Installation (Labor) Varies based on scope

Costs can vary based on project size, material selection, and site conditions.
